Virginia S. Hayward 67 of East Patchogue died on May 1, 1999. She was self-employed as a home care aide. Mrs. Hayward is survived by her daughters, Susan June Alexander of Florida, Karen Hayward of East Patchogue and Linda Lee Vetter of Patchogue; sons James Chas Hayward and Willard Raymond Hayward III both of East Patchogue; sisters, Louise Saunders of Orlando, Florida and Anna Seaman of East Patchogue; brothers, Charles Skinner of Tallahassee, Fkorida and Paul Skinner of Bay Shore, N.Y.; 12 grandchildren and one great-grand-child. She was predeceased by her husband, Willard Raymond Hayward, Jr.. Funeral arrangements were entrusted to the Ruland Funeral Home, Patchogue. Services will be held at the United Methodist Church today at 10a.m. with the Reverend Gary B. Betts officiating. Interment will follow in Washington Park, Coram.
